Beneath a Blanket covered in NSW Stars
The night sky across New South Wales is a breathtaking sight. Thousands upon stars twinkle check here faintly, creating a sparkling tapestry that stretches {as far as the eye can see. A cover of darkness envelops the land, allowing these stars to truly radiate.
Should you happen to stargazing underneath an open area or simply stare into the night, the stars of NSW offer a wonderfully awe-inspiring display.
Some tips for stargazing include:
* Find a pitch-black location, away from city lights.
* Take binoculars or a telescope for better viewing.
* Be prepared for cool temperatures as nights can get chilly even in summer.
